Output 161ccf16b8e6623d996baba6bd805a40d87571de730574b1597f13c05ecf3119:0

value
57809867
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c59b1f09e7ae69cd6e8d91b46aa2119dca91c76 OP_EQUALVERIFY OP_CHECKSIG
address
1CLWEuo2fCjvM6e4xQvConBd7rxpAsy67r
transaction
161ccf16b8e6623d996baba6bd805a40d87571de730574b1597f13c05ecf3119
spent
true